Haledon, New Jersey (United States). From 9 to 13 June 2019, the Pre-Chapter Commission met to plan the first Chapter of Saint Joseph Province (SEC). The Chapter will take place from 9 to 15 October in Newton, New Jersey. This Chapter will be a significant moment for the new Province, consisting of the previous Province of St. Philip the Apostle USA in the United States and CND Our Lady of the Cape Province of Canada.

The Pre-Chapter Commission, led by Sister Maria Colombo, Provincial Secretary and Moderator of the Provincial Chapter, is made up of FMA representatives of the various works and Sectors:

Sister Theresa Kelly, Director of Sacred Heart Retreat Center and College Theology Teacher.

Sister Cora Beboso, Canadian vocational director

Sister Michelle Geiger, Principal of the Girls Academy of Our Lady High School.

Sister Brittany Harrison, Coordinator for Youth Pastoral

The members of the Commission were engaged in studying and deepening the pre-chapter document centered on the Wedding at Cana, as they planned a program for the development of the Provincial Chapter which gives ample space to the voice of the young people who will participate.

The Provincial, Sister Joanne Holloman said: “Our first provincial chapter is a historical moment, and I trust in the prayers and good will of our sisters to make this an experience of mutual discernment, as we walk together in faith with and for young people”.
